55/1.7 is sharper wide open and has less CA compared to 80/1.7.Also 55/110/250 is better than 80/110/250,thoug more versatile combo will be 55/120 macro/250.

Tamron 70-300 is OK fromm 100mm to 300mm.Close up performance is poor.Sigma 100-400 is much better in every respect,save size,weight and price.

Sony G 70-200/4 Mk2 is a very good for landscape.GM 70-200/2.8 Mk2 is excellent - slightly sharper and contrastier.I have both and can recommend both,depending on circumstance.

Batis 25 is a better choice if you care about Zeiss IQ (unique colour rendition+microcontrast).Sigma 24 offers manual aperture ring and comparable sharpness.

Try Sigma 17/4 DG DN Contemporary.It is worth a sin.Tiny,solid,manual apertutre ring,sharp,very good colours and not expensive.
